Description

1,3-Di(3-Thienyl)Prop-2-En-1-One is a high-purity organic compound featuring a conjugated enone system bridging two thiophene rings. This unique molecular architecture makes it a valuable building block and intermediate in advanced chemical synthesis. It is primarily utilized by researchers and manufacturers in the pharmaceutical and materials science sectors for developing novel active ingredients and functional organic materials.

Basic Information

Item Detail
Product Name 1,3-Di(3-Thienyl)Prop-2-En-1-One
CAS No. 194469-38-0
Molecular Formula C11H8OS2
Molecular Weight 220.31 g/mol
Synonyms 1,3-Bis(3-thienyl)-2-propen-1-one; (E)-1,3-Di(thiophen-3-yl)prop-2-en-1-one; 3,3'-(1-Oxo-2-propen-1,3-diyl)dithiophene; 1,3-Di-3-thienyl-2-propen-1-one; Bis(3-thienyl)propenone; DTEPO; 194469-38-0

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from heat and incompatible materials. The product is light-sensitive and should be handled under appropriate conditions to maintain stability.
